The Role of AI Chatbots in Property Management
AI chatbots are automated conversational agents designed to interact with tenants through text or voice interfaces. Featuring nat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ning capabilities, these chatbots can understand, interpret, and respond to tenant inquiries in real-time. This technology bridges the gap between landlords and tenants, providing a reliable and consistent point of contact for property-related issues.
Renter support is essential in rental properties. From maintenance requests to lease inquiries, tenants require timely responses to guarantee their living experience remains positive. Traditional support ways often involve delays, mainly during non-business hours or peak times. AI chatbots handle these challenges by offering 24/7 availability, streamlining communication, and automating repetitive tasks.
Benefits of AI Chatbots for Tenant Support
Round-the-Clock Availability
Unlike human staff, AI chatbots are always online, ensuring tenants get immediate responses, whether it’s a late-night emergency or a weekend query.
Efficiency in Handling Queries
Chatbots excel at tackling common tenant questions, like rent payment schedules, lease terms, or community authorities. By automating these interactions, property managers can focus on more complex tasks.
Quick Resolution of Maintenance Requests
AI chatbots can integrate with property management systems to facilitate reporting maintenance issues, categorize requests based on urgency, and even schedule fixing services.
Personalized Tenant Experience
Advanced chatbots can access tenant-specific information to deliver certain responses, enhancing satisfaction and building trust.
Cost-Effectiveness
AI chatbots lower operational costs without compromising service quality by minimizing the urge for vast support teams.
Scalability
Chatbots are highly scalable, making them a perfect solution for managing communication across many properties or large rental communities.
Challenges and Considerations
While AI chatbots offer multiple advantages, there are challenges to tackle. Ensuring data security and privacy is vital, as chatbots handle sensitive tenant information. Moreover, some tenants may prefer human interaction for complex or emotional problems, necessitating a hybrid approach that combines chatbot efficiency with human empathy.

Can AI chatbots manage maintenance requests in rental properties?
Yes, AI chatbots can be essential in managing maintenance requests in rental properties, offering significant benefits for tenants and property managers. Chatbots equipped with AI can streamline reporting and tackle maintenance issues, guaranteeing the process is practical and transparent.
Here’s how AI chatbots typically handle maintenance requests:
- Tenant Input: Tenants can easily report issues to the chatbot by describing the problem. The chatbot can ask for additional details, such as the type of issue (e.g., plumbing, electrical, heating) or the severity (e.g., urgent or non-urgent). It can also guide tenants through troubleshooting steps to decide if the issue can be resolved without involving maintenance personnel.
- Categorization and Prioritization: Once a request is made, the chatbot can automatically categorize and prioritize the issue based on urgency. For example, a broken water pipe or heating failure might be marked as high-priority, while a non-urgent issue like a lightbulb replacement could be categorized as low-priority. This helps property managers and maintenance teams handle the most critical issues, minimizing tenant disruptions.
- Scheduling and Notifications: AI chatbots can integrate with property management software to automatically schedule maintenance appointments or notify the appropriate personnel or contractors about the problem. Tenants will be kept informed throughout the process, receiving updates about when a technician will arrive or if there are any delays.
- Data Monitoring: AI chatbots can track the status of maintenance requests, keeping a log of all tenant-reported issues and resolutions. This allows property managers to observe trends, identify recurring problems, and evaluate the performance of maintenance teams. Moreover, the chatbot can follow up with tenants after resolving the issue to guarantee their satisfaction.
Overall, AI chatbots help guarantee that maintenance requests are efficiently under control, decreasing wait times for tenants and improving operational workflows for property managers.
How do AI chatbots benefit inhabitants in rental properties?
AI chatbots bring multiple benefits to tenants in rental properties, significantly enhancing their experience and satisfaction. The primary benefits include:
- 24/7 Accessibility: One of the most essential benefits for inhabitants is that AI chatbots are available round-the-clock. Whether it’s late at night, over the weekend, or during holidays, tenants can get answers to their queries instantly. This ensures tenants are not left waiting office hours to resolve issues, especially in urgent situations.
- Instant and Accurate Responses: AI chatbots feature vast databases of information related to the property, leases, payment schedules, and maintenance procedures. As a result, tenants can receive fast, accurate responses to frequently asked questions without waiting for a property manager or receptionist to become available.
- Seamless Maintenance Requests: Tenants often need maintenance services when something breaks down in their unit. AI chatbots facilitate this process by allowing tenants to easily submit maintenance requests, categorizing the issues based on urgency or type (e.g., plumbing, heating, electrical). These requests are then forwarded to the appropriate personnel or contractors, reducing delays in resolution.
- Customized Assistance: Advanced AI chatbots can access tenant-certain information, allowing them to deliver a more personalized experience. For example, suppose a tenant asks about rent payments. In that case, the chatbot can pull up the tenant’s account details, including the amount due, the next payment date, and any outstanding balance. This customization builds trust and makes interactions more active.
- Convenient Access to Information: Tenants can use AI chatbots to quickly find crucial documents like lease agreements, community guidelines, or FAQs. This decreases the need to contact property managers or staff for simple requests, empowering tenants with more self-service options.
